New Lenovo Thinkpad has a Wacom tablet built in
Now this is a serious laptop. The new Lenovo Thinkpad W700 is not only gigantic, featuring a 17-inch screen and a full numerical pad next to the keyboard, but it also has a Wacom tablet built in. Yes, one of the expensive, fancy tablets used by professional graphic artists, built in right next to the track pad.
It's enough to make anyone who uses a tablet on any kind of regular basis green with envy. They'll pay dearly for it, however, as this guy will set you back $2,978 when it's released next month. Start saving your pennies, artists.
